There are many Augmented Reality trends that have been seen in the past few years. One of the most significant changes is the increasing use of augmented reality in businesses. More and more companies are using Augmented Reality to train their employees and to showcase their products. Additionally, the education sector is also beginning to use augmented reality to create more immersive and interactive learning experiences. Another trend that has been gaining traction is the use of Augmented Reality for marketing purposes. Many brands are now using Augmented Reality to create interactive experiences that allow customers to try out products before they buy them. Lastly, social media platforms are also beginning to incorporating Augmented Reality into their offerings. For example, Snapchat has introduced filters that use Augmented Reality to change the user’s appearance. These are just some of the ways in which Augmented Reality is changing the world as we know it.

Remote video collaboration and face filters:

Due to the pandemic, daily activities have huge effects as everything has become remote. The many major tech companies such as Google, Amazon and Microsoft has allowed people to work from home. This has become a trend this year and will continue indefinitely for a considerable period. 

Many technology companies such as Zoom, Google, and Microsoft have introduced a conferencing app, which became one of the significant popularity in 2020. Additionally, there were around 62 million downloads just only in March. Working and studying in a remote environment made many people uncomfortable with their physical appearance, which was proved through research. At the same time, many other people felt the “zoom fatigue” from being on a video call for a considerable time. 

The use of virtual backgrounds and face touch-ups is becoming increasingly popular, as people look for ways to improve their video calling experience. Augmented Reality (AR) technology is providing new solutions that make video calls more interactive and enjoyable. Additionally, AR can help to keep an individual’s privacy at a very high level. Virtual backgrounds can be used to change the appearance of a person’s surroundings, while face touch-ups can be used to improve the person’s appearance in different ways. This trend is likely to continue as AR technology becomes more advanced and accessible.

AR-powered short video content 

Due to the pandemic, there has been an explosion of short video content that includes shorts, Instagram reels, Tiktok, Snapchat spotlight and Thriller. This has helped people share their lives’ daily updates with their friends and relatives. To make videos more engaging, video editing software’s are used to augment the AR features such as lenses, virtual backgrounds and many face filters. Many businesses such as Walmart have also opted for using short video content to help them demonstrate the latest products of the potential customers. They are also providing the users to try these products virtually with the help of technology. 

Additionally, TikTok has also become a considerable part of short video content, which has sparked interest in e-commerce. The companies are promoting their product with the help of TikTok shortly.

Rise of AR avatars in live streaming

Due to privacy reasons, new technology has emerged in this society known as AR avatars. This helps with more personalized and unique communications and protects the privacy of individuals. 

Japan has around 4000 virtual Youtubers. Instead of facing the camera themselves, they opt for the digital version of themselves in the form of an avatar to show their digital versions. Additionally, they use twitch as a form of the online streaming platform, and you can take advantage of virtual makeovers with the AR effects of snaps. This has given them a much more creative way to stream.
